Dow Total Cost of Revenue increased by 2.7% to $9.15B in Q1 2026 compared to the prior quarter. Year-over-year, this metric declined by 6.2%, from $9.76B to $9.15B. Over 4 years (FY 2021 to FY 2025), Total Cost of Revenue shows a downward trend with a -4.1% CAGR. This is a positive signal — lower values indicate better performance for this metric.

total_cost_of_revenue| Q2 '21 | Q3 '21 | Q4 '21 | Q1 '22 | Q2 '22 | Q3 '22 | Q4 '22 | Q1 '23 | Q2 '23 | Q3 '23 | Q4 '23 | Q1 '24 | Q2 '24 | Q3 '24 | Q4 '24 | Q1 '25 | Q2 '25 | Q3 '25 | Q4 '25 | Q1 '26 |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Value | $10.74B | $11.61B | $11.78B | $12.40B | $12.90B | $12.38B | $10.66B | $10.63B | $9.88B | $9.59B | $9.65B | $9.49B | $9.59B | $9.81B | $9.47B | $9.76B | $9.52B | $9.24B | $8.91B | $9.15B |
| QoQ Change | — | +8.1% | +1.4% | +5.3% | +4.0% | -4.0% | -13.9% | -0.3% | -7.1% | -2.9% | +0.6% | -1.6% | +1.1% | +2.3% | -3.5% | +3.1% | -2.4% | -2.9% | -3.6% | +2.7% |
| YoY Change | — | — | — | — | +20.1% | +6.6% | -9.5% | -14.3% | -23.4% | -22.5% | -9.5% | -10.7% | -2.9% | +2.3% | -1.8% | +2.9% | -0.7% | -5.8% | -5.9% | -6.2% |
